I can't find the thread. Rest,,,when you hand your S&S card to one of the dealers at any of the gaming tables, let them know you would like to purchase an "X" amount of chips. One of the pit bosses will scan your card and bring you a receipt to sign. Once you sign it,,give it to the dealer and they will in turn give you the amount of chips you requested. Easy Peasy!!:D Once you receive your chips,,play a hand or two and then cash in your chips,,,that's how you can avoid the 10% fee. I usually purchase chips in $500.00 increments so I'm not sure if there is a max amount per transaction. I do know that once your request for the chips has been made,MSC will authorize the credit card you have on file for the additional amount which will ultimately be applied to your onboard spending account.
